Frequently Asked Questions About Insurance in New Carlisle

What are the minimum auto insurance requirements for drivers in New Carlisle, Ohio?

In New Carlisle, Ohio, all drivers must carry minimum liability coverage of $25,000 for bodily injury per person, $50,000 for bodily injury per accident, and $25,000 for property damage. However, given New Carlisle's proximity to major highways like I-70 and rural roads with higher accident risks, many local advisors recommend increasing these limits and adding comprehensive and collision coverage, especially for protection against weather-related damage and uninsured motorists.

How does New Carlisle's location in 'Tornado Alley' of Ohio affect homeowners insurance?

New Carlisle sits in an area of Ohio prone to severe storms and tornadoes, which can increase homeowners insurance premiums and necessitate specific endorsements. Residents should ensure their policy includes windstorm coverage and consider separate deductibles for wind/hail damage. It's also wise to review coverage limits for outbuildings, common in New Carlisle's semi-rural setting, and document possessions for claims after severe weather events.

Are there specific insurance considerations for farms or agribusinesses in the New Carlisle area?

Yes, given New Carlisle's agricultural surroundings in Clark County, farm and ranch insurance is crucial. This specialized coverage typically bundles liability, property (for barns, equipment, and livestock), and crop insurance into one policy. Local providers often tailor plans to cover risks like equipment theft, livestock mortality, and liability from farm tours or roadside stands, which are common in this community.

What health insurance options are available to residents of New Carlisle, Ohio?

New Carlisle residents can access health insurance through employers, the federal Health Insurance Marketplace, Medicaid (if eligible), or local providers like Mercy Health and Kettering Health Network. Given the area's mix of urban and rural demographics, it's important to compare network coverage, especially for specialists in nearby Springfield or Dayton, and consider supplemental plans for gaps in Medicare, popular among the older population.

Do New Carlisle's seasonal weather patterns influence auto and property insurance needs?

Absolutely. New Carlisle experiences cold winters with ice and snow, increasing risks of auto accidents and home issues like frozen pipes, and hot summers with potential for hail or storm damage. For auto insurance, comprehensive coverage for weather-related incidents is advisable. For homeowners, ensuring policies cover winterization damage and reviewing sump pump or sewer backup endorsements is key due to heavy rainfall and spring thaws in the region.

Finding the Best Whole Life Insurance Companies in New Carlisle, Ohio

For residents of New Carlisle, Ohio, securing financial stability for your family is a priority that resonates deeply in our close-knit community. Whole life insurance stands out as a cornerstone of long-term planning, offering both a death benefit and a cash value component that grows over time. When searching for the best whole life insurance companies, it's crucial to consider providers that understand the unique dynamics of our area, from the agricultural roots to the growing suburban families. In Ohio, insurers must navigate state-specific regulations, which can impact policy options and pricing, making local expertise invaluable. Companies like Northwestern Mutual, New York Life, and MassMutual often rank highly due to their strong financial ratings and history of dividend payments, but your choice should align with your personal goals and budget. One key factor for New Carlisle residents is the blend of rural and semi-urban lifestyles, which may influence coverage needs; for instance, those with farm assets or small businesses might require higher policy limits to protect their legacy. To find the best whole life insurance companies, start by assessing your long-term objectives, such as funding education for children at Tecumseh Local Schools or covering final expenses without burdening loved ones. Consulting with a local independent agent can provide tailored insights, as they can compare offerings from multiple insurers and explain how Ohio's laws affect your policy. Additionally, consider companies that offer flexible payment options, especially given the economic diversity in our region, where incomes can vary from manufacturing jobs to entrepreneurial ventures. It's also wise to review customer service records and claims satisfaction, as a reliable insurer should be there when you need them most, whether you're in New Carlisle or beyond. Remember, the best whole life insurance companies will not only provide competitive rates but also demonstrate a commitment to policyholder dividends and transparent communication. As you explore options, prioritize insurers with high ratings from agencies like A.M. Best, ensuring they have the financial strength to honor promises over decades. Ultimately, investing in a whole life policy is about peace of mind for your family's future, and by taking the time to research and consult locally, you can make an informed decision that safeguards your legacy in our beloved Ohio community.
